Fourth Watch
Composer: Paff, John
Instrumentation: Solo and Piano Instruments: Piano, Tuba
Genre: Contemporarywith Piano
Fourth Watch is a suite in three movements for Tuba and Piano. The name refers to usage of the use of the interval of the fourth and its accompanying quartal harmony. The first movement begins in the key of C, with standard tertian harmony and the fourths are brought in soon in a subtle manner. As the movement progresses, the fourths and quartal harmony become more of a force.
The second movement, a slower one compared with the first, starts with quartal harmony and is supplemented with tertian elements. The third movement is more of a combination of quartal and tertian segments. With regard to the piano part, as quartal chord intervals can be a challenge to pianists, care was taken to have the quartal sections accommodate the player by not changing overly fast.
By its nature of involving quartal and tertian harmonies, Fourth Watch is different than many compositions and, while having some of the inevitable dissonance of quartal harmony, it maintains a modicum of normalcy for the benefit of players and audiences. Fourth Watch will grab the listener’s attention, but the changes in the music and the relatively short length of the movements will keep those unfamiliar with these sounds from becoming lost or bored.

Capricious Suite
Composer: Paff, John
Instrumentation: Solo and Piano Instruments: Piano, Tuba
Genre: Contemporarywith PianoBy the title, one might expect something unusual, and they would be correct. This three-movement suite begins with a slow tempo introduction, moving to a faster main part. However, soon some additional sounds emerge. In places, the player is asked to sing through the instrument, while playing other notes. To make this more manageable, the played notes are usually in a low range and do not move quickly. This allows the vocal sounds to be made more easily. The player may choose their most comfortable octave to sing the vocal notes. Most are written as “ah” sounds, with the exception of a few that are done while not playing a note, and are written as “la”, and still intended to be through the instrument. Other “extra” sounds are done with tapping and occasional stomping. Tapping can be done on any nearby surface. A plastic shoebox works well and could be placed on a close-by table or chair. Tapping could also be done on one’s instrument, but many might prefer another surface.
The three movements are in contrasting styles and tempos. There is enough “normal” material in this piece to make it more friendly to an audience than it could be, considering the extra sounds. Players may need to work on the singing while playing aspect in order to feel comfortable doing it. Also, players may want to try several tapping surfaces to see which they prefer. 15 Tuba Trios
Composer: Paff, John
Instrumentation: Trio Instruments: Tuba
Genre: Contemporary15 Tuba Trios is a collection of fifteen pieces for three tubas exploring a variety of styles and ranging in difficulty from medium easy to medium difficult. The first part ranges to slightly above the bass clef staff, while the other two voices range to the middle and below the staff. These trios are intended to give players a fulfilling experience with this type of ensemble, which, because of the problems low register harmony can present, require special listening and dynamic adjustment skills. The trios cover a diverse set of styles and are designed to give each of the three players a part that is important and integral to the piece. Ruby, The
Composer: Paff, John
Instrumentation: Quartet Instruments: Euphonium, Tuba
Genre: Contemporary“The Ruby” is a medium easy quartet for two euphoniums and two tubas. It is based on a three-note motif, which I heard several times in a health facility with Ruby in its name. The three notes were sounded when and IV pump reached the end of a cycle and were the intervals of a major second followed by minor third. I could think of at least four tunes/ songs that began with these three notes and decided that they could be used to start other original melodies.In “The Ruby,” the three movement titles refer to shades of red, as red is perhaps the most quickly noticed property of a ruby. The music in the movements is not attempting to personify these shades, but is a fast (relatively), slow, fast arrangement utilizing different approaches to the starting motif. It is designed to help less experienced players have success with ensemble performance. Everyone has important parts, but the ranges, key signatures and rhythms are fairly tame. 4th Avenue Suite
Composer: Paff, John
Instrumentation: Sextet Instruments: Euphonium, Tuba
Genre: ContemporaryEEETTT4th Avenue Suite is a composition set for three euphoniums and three tubas. Its inspiration comes from a vacation at North Carolina’s Outer Banks when we were staying in a rental house on 4th Avenue. The tunes are derived from a sequence of numbers used to open the digital door lock of the house for that week. The numbers, 3 6 8 2 4 3, are employed by their numerical placement in a musical scale. I thought: “What if; these numbers could be made into a tune (or several)?” The entire suite is not confined to these notes, but the tunes in the movements have grown out of this sequence. To construct several generations from a set of notes seemed enough, so no attempt has been made to relate the movements to events or situations. The movements are subtitled as follows: I. Intrada; II. Intermezzo; III. Minuet; and IV. Finale. The challenge level is Medium to Medium Difficult.
